[Interaction of shift work and psychological capital on abnormal glucose and lipid metabolism among natural gas field workers].

ABSTRACT

Objective:

To explore the interaction between shift work and psychological capital on abnormal glucose and lipid metabolism.

Methods:

A convenient sampling survey of demographics characteristics, shift work and psychological capital was conducted on 1 415 natural gas field workers by questionnaire in October 2018,and their physiological and biochemical indexes were measured according to standard norms. Multivariate logistic regression model was used to analyze the interaction between shift work and psychological capital on abnormal glucose and lipid metabolism.

Results:

For 1 415 subjectsthe prevalence of abnormal blood glucose was 21.2%, the prevalence of diabetes was 8.3%.The prevalence of abnormal total cholesterol was 40.4%, the prevalence of hypercholesterolemia was 11.3%.The prevalence of abnormal triglyceride was 41.6%, the prevalence of hypertriglyceridemia was 24.7%.The detection rate of Low-density Lipoprotein was 17.3%, the detection rate of Low-density Lipoprotein was 4.0%, and the detection rate of high-density Lipoprotein was 1.3%. Multiple logistic regression model analysis showed that shift work, the low level of self-efficacy and the low level of optimism was positively associated with abnormal blood glucose, respectively (P<0.05). Shift work was positively associated with abnormal triglyceride (P<0.05). However, there was no interaction between shift work, low self-efficacy, low hope, low resilience, and low optimism on abnormal glucose and lipid metabolism.

Conclusion:

Shift work was a risk factor of abnormal blood glucose and triglyceride, self-efficacy and optimism were protective factors of abnormal blood glucose. There was no multiplicative interaction between shift work and psychological capital on abnormal glucose and lipid metabolism in the study population.
